North Ayrshire Council launch meal and activities programme for Easter break

North Ayrshire Council’s holiday school meals and activities programme is back for the Easter break, running until Friday, April 12.

Activities will take place from 11.30am to 12.30pm each day, with lunch being served from 12.30pm to 1pm. All meals and activities are free and registration is not required.

Schools taking part in the initiative are Dreghorn Primary, Elderbank Primary in Irvine and Hayocks Primary in Stevenston.

There are also sessions at Fullarton Community Hub in Irvine, The Playz in Kilwinning, Vineburgh Community Centre in Irvine and Woodwynd Community Centre in Kilwinning. Contact the centres for times.

Pupils from all of North Ayrshire’s primary schools are welcome at any of the venues.

Councillor Jim Montgomerie said: “Our holiday school meals initiative continues to go from strength to strength, ensuring that young people have access to nutritious food throughout the year.

“Holiday hunger remains a real issue across Scotland and the UK but this initiative has had an extremely positive impact on our young people so far, something which we are very proud of.”
